慢性肾脏病(chronickidneydisease,CKD)是全球范围的公共健康问题,影响着全球约8.5亿人;流行病学数据显示,我国人群患病率已从2012年的10.8% 显著下降至2023年的 8.2%[2] ,但成年患者基数仍高达8200万,疾病负担依然严峻。(剩余8126字)
